Zhen Guo is a researcher in space robotics, with a focus on the dynamics and control of free-floating dual-arm systems. Their most cited work, "Coordinated Dynamics Control of a Free-Floating Dual-arm Space Robot" (2010, 6 citations), addresses a critical challenge in orbital manipulation: controlling a robot mounted on a spacecraft whose base position and orientation are not actively stabilized. Guo’s research explores how the coordinated motion of two arms and a grasped object can disturb the base’s attitude, complicating precision tasks. By developing control strategies that account for these dynamic couplings, Guo has contributed foundational insights into the safe and effective operation of space robots for satellite servicing, debris removal, and assembly. Though their citation count is modest, the work is notable for tackling a niche yet essential problem in autonomous space operations. Guo’s research is particularly relevant for students and engineers working on the next generation of free-flying robotic systems, where maintaining base stability without dedicated thrusters is a key design constraint.
